Output d2e6b64c15176260d36e8ee4efe03bd5bfa319ee67e6d3645122ea48c299fc6c:1

value
2630694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 befe23b2670cc35bb3043e9975d58b21fe14280d OP_EQUAL
address
3K6tkuhfJSoAnQSLL4yv6X79AgFX7Ep7aR
transaction
d2e6b64c15176260d36e8ee4efe03bd5bfa319ee67e6d3645122ea48c299fc6c
spent
true